Anders Melchiorsen
c218757336
Accept both domains and entities in influxdb include ( #19927 )
...
* Accept both domains and entities in influxdb include
* Explicit test
* Remove lint
2019-01-15 16:20:51 -08:00
Fabian Affolter
25f6302813
Switch to ipapi.co ( fixes #19846 ) ( #19886 )
...
* Switch to ipapi.co (fixes #19846 )
* Fix name
* Update name
2019-01-15 16:18:57 -08:00
Alexei Chetroi
4b3d4b275e
Zha light.turn_on service fixes. ( #20085 )
...
Set color only if light supports color mode.
Set color temp only light supports color temp.
Update entity's brightness only if Zigbee command to set the brightness
was sent successfuly.
2019-01-15 16:12:22 -08:00
Rohan Kapoor
f36755e447
Switch geofency tests to using an unauthenticated HTTP client ( #20080 )
2019-01-15 16:11:30 -08:00
Paulus Schoutsen
9fd21d20ae
Fix loading translations for embedded platforms ( #20122 )
...
* Fix loading translations for embedded platforms
* Update doc string
* Lint
2019-01-15 16:06:04 -08:00
Paulus Schoutsen
cd6679eb5b
Updated frontend to 20190115.0
2019-01-15 15:35:18 -08:00
Tommy Jonsson
1b79872dd6
Add notify.html5_dismiss service ( #19912 )
...
* Add notify.html5_dismiss service
* fix test
* add can_dismiss
* fix service data payload
* fix hasattr -> getattr
* fixes
* move dismiss service to html5
* fix services.yaml
* fix line to long
2019-01-15 15:31:57 -08:00
Morgan Kesler
732743aeb5
Missed one small comment
2019-01-15 17:27:56 -05:00
emontnemery
0ec1401be7
Minor refactoring of MQTT availability ( #20136 )
...
* Small refactor of MQTT availability
* Use dict[key] for required config keys and keys with default values.
2019-01-15 14:26:37 -08:00
Morgan Kesler
cc166bf6a7
Enable setting alarm mode night for arlo platform
2019-01-15 17:19:04 -05:00
starkillerOG
11602c1da0
Improve Philips Hue color conversion 2 ( #20118 )
...
* Add gamut capability to color util
* Include gamut in hue_test
* Improve Philips Hue color conversion
* correct import for new location hue.light
* include file changes between PR's
* update aiohue version
* update aiohue version
* update aiohue version
* fix hue_test
Now Idea why it failed compared to the previous time
* Include gamut in hue_test
* fix hue_test
* Try to test hue gamut conversion
supply a color that is well outside the color gamut of the light, and see if the response is correctly converted to within the reach of the light.
* switch from gamut A to gamut B for the tests.
* remove white space in blanck line
* Fix gamut hue test
* Add Gamut tests for the util.color
* fix hue gamut test
* fix hue gamut test
* Improve Philips Hue color conversion
2019-01-15 11:30:50 -08:00
Robert Svensson
a3f0d55737
Change deCONZ to embedded platforms ( #20113 )
...
Move all platforms into components/deconz
2019-01-15 19:29:56 +01:00
Adam Mills
336b6adc88
Split time_pattern triggers from time trigger ( #19825 )
...
* Split interval triggers from time trigger
* Default smaller interval units to zero
* Rename interval to schedule
* Rename schedule to time_pattern
2019-01-15 09:33:34 -08:00
emontnemery
5b53bd6aa0
Move MQTT platforms under the component ( #20050 )
...
* Move MQTT platforms under the component
2019-01-15 17:31:06 +01:00
Eliseo Martelli
5fd1053a38
fixed gtt to report isotime ( #20128 )
2019-01-15 13:39:43 +01:00
Rohan Kapoor
80bc42af4f
Use voluptuous to perform validation for the geofency webhook ( #20067 )
...
* Use voluptuous to perform validation for the geofency webhook
* Add missing attribute to schema
* Lint
2019-01-15 12:50:09 +01:00
Fredrik Erlandsson
c8d885fb78
Fix tellduslive discovery and auth issues ( #20023 )
...
* fix for #19954 , discovered tellsticks shows up to be configured
* fix for #19954 , authentication issues
* updated tests
* move I/O to executer thread pool
* Apply suggestions from code review
Co-Authored-By: fredrike <fredrik.e@gmail.com>
2019-01-15 06:36:17 +01:00
Andrew Sayre
e73569c203
Added partial detection to async_add_job ( #20119 )
2019-01-14 15:08:44 -08:00
emontnemery
0f3b6f1739
Reconfigure MQTT lock component if discovery info is changed ( #19468 )
...
* Reconfigure MQTT lock component if discovery info is changed
* Use dict[key] for required config keys and keys with default config schema values.
2019-01-14 21:01:42 +01:00
Aaron Bach
af2949f85f
Embed OpenUV platforms into the component ( #20072 )
...
* Embed OpenUV platforms into the component
* Updated CODEOWNERS
* Updated .coveragerc
2019-01-14 11:44:00 -07:00
Aaron Bach
b3886820b4
Embed SimpliSafe platforms into the component ( #20069 )
...
* Embed SimpliSafe platforms into the component
* Updated CODEOWNERS
* Updated .coveragerc
2019-01-14 11:42:48 -07:00
Aaron Bach
d717d9f6be
Embed RainMachine platforms into the component ( #20066 )
...
* Embed RainMachine platforms into the component
* Updated CODEOWNERS
* Updated .coveragerc
2019-01-14 11:42:21 -07:00
Otto Winter
f225570980
Move ESPHome Source Files ( #20092 )
...
* Move ESPHome source files
* Update .coveragerc
* Update CODEOWNERS
2019-01-14 09:00:48 -07:00
Morten Lüneborg
e505a9b7b4
Fix ihc issues caused by update to defusedxml ( #20091 )
...
* Update __init__.py
* Update __init__.py
2019-01-14 13:12:57 +01:00
Aaron Bach
ef79566864
Adjust OpenUV integration for upcoming API limit changes ( #19949 )
...
* Adjust OpenUV integration for upcoming API limit changes
* Added fix for "Invalid API Key"
* Bugfix
* Add initial nighttime check
* Move from polling to a service-based model
* Fixed test
* Removed unnecessary scan interval
* Fixed test
* Moving test imports
* Member comments
* Hound
* Removed unused import
2019-01-14 13:12:06 +01:00
Alok Saboo
fff3cb0b46
Change return text code for alarm control panels ( #20055 )
...
* Change return text code for alarmdotcom
* Change return text code for ialarm
* Change return text code for IFTTT
* Change return text code for manual alarm panel
* Change return text code for manual MQTT alarm
* Change return text code for MQTT
* Change return text code for Simplisafe
2019-01-14 13:02:30 +01:00
shred86
5652a4a58b
Bump abode to 0.15.0 ( #20064 )
...
Fix for motion sensor states
2019-01-14 13:01:59 +01:00
Thom Troy
cb9e0c03d5
fix logic error in dubln bus ( #20075 )
2019-01-14 10:51:37 +01:00
Paulus Schoutsen
d6d28dd3e9
Lowercase code format ( #20077 )
2019-01-14 10:49:38 +01:00
Ville Skyttä
eb610e6093
Upgrade pytest to 4.1.1 ( #20088 )
2019-01-14 10:05:24 +02:00
Spencer Oberstadt
7db28d3d91
Add Roku hub and remote ( #17548 )
...
* add roku remote component
* remove name config (for now)
* update coveragerc and requirements_all
* fix linting errors
* remove extra requirements entry
* fix flake8 errors
* remove some references to apple tv
* remove redundant REQUIREMENTS
* Update requirements_all.txt
* Pass hass_config to load_platform
* don't expose registry constant
* remove unnecessary registry list
* use await instead of add_job
* use ensure_list
* fix code style
* some review fixes
* code style fixes
* stop using async
* use add with update
* fix whitespace
* remove I/O from init loop
* move import
2019-01-14 08:44:30 +01:00
Rohan Kapoor
452d7cfd61
Return web.Response correctly
2019-01-13 17:07:45 -08:00
Rohan Kapoor
7f3871028d
Split out gpslogger into a separate component and platform ( #20044 )
...
* Split out gpslogger into a separate component and platform
* Lint
* Lint
* Increase test coverage
2019-01-14 01:09:47 +01:00
Rohan Kapoor
e476949c3e
Remove allow_extra
2019-01-13 13:35:13 -08:00
Rohan Kapoor
9036aafc81
Lint
2019-01-13 13:26:51 -08:00
Teemu R
2a2318b7f6
warning -> debug, this should not have been visible to users ( #20061 )
2019-01-13 21:31:08 +01:00
Rohan Kapoor
b75356d532
Validate test mode schema as well
2019-01-13 12:12:04 -08:00
Rohan Kapoor
0f92d061c4
Use voluptuous to validate the webhook schema
2019-01-13 11:49:20 -08:00
Austin Drummond
3b83a64f7c
Add support for HomeKit Controller covers ( #19866 )
...
* Added support for HomeKit Controller covers
* removed copied code
* more linting fixes
* added device type to service info
* added checks for value in characteristics
* added state stopped parsing
* removed logger
* removed unused args
* fixed inits
* removed unused imports
* fixed lint issues
* fixed lint issues
* remove state_unknown
* remove validation of kwargs in homekit controller covers
* guarantee tilt position is not none before setting
2019-01-13 19:09:47 +01:00
Matt Snyder
db87842335
Show persistent notification on Doorbird schedule failure ( #20033 )
...
* Remove unnecessary return.
Add persistent notification on failure to configure doorbird schedule.
* Update doorbirdpy to 2.0.5
* Fix bare except
* Bump version again
* Lint
* Return false
2019-01-13 18:47:50 +01:00
Paulus Schoutsen
798f630029
Updated frontend to 20190113.0
2019-01-13 09:38:35 -08:00
Paulus Schoutsen
96b8c517f0
Update translations
2019-01-13 09:38:22 -08:00
Anders Melchiorsen
4af4b2d10e
Fix remote.harmony_change_channel services.yaml indentation ( #20051 )
2019-01-13 16:39:50 +01:00
Otto Winter
2339cb05ad
Fix errors in ESPHome integration ( #20048 )
...
* Fix Home Assistant State Import
* Fix cover state
* Fix fan supported features
* Fix typo
2019-01-13 15:52:23 +01:00
carstenschroeder
aae6ff830a
ADS service: Enable use of templates for value ( #20024 )
2019-01-13 14:23:22 +01:00
Alok Saboo
1c11394f5f
Change alarm panel code format ( #20037 )
...
* Change code format
* Update elkm1 code format
* Update alarmdecodes code_format
* Update alarmdotcom code_format
* Update concord232 code_format
* Update envisalink code_format
* Update ialarm code_format
* Update ifttt code_format
* Update manual alarm code_format
* Update manual mqtt code_format
* Update mqtt code_format
* Update ness code_format
* Update nx584 code_format
* Update satel_integra code_format
* Update simplisafe code_format
* Update verisure code_format
* Change text to be consistent with the Polymer PR
2019-01-13 11:59:12 +01:00
Ville Skyttä
162e2b8385
Upgrade pytest to 4.1.0 ( #20013 )
2019-01-13 08:56:26 +01:00
Caleb Dunn
e295ca7b8e
update to pyunifi 2.16 ( #20042 )
...
* update to pyunifi 2.16
* update requirements to version 2.16
2019-01-13 08:56:05 +01:00
Rohan Kapoor
3e325a4ef9
Remove dead test code
2019-01-12 20:24:55 -08:00
Rohan Kapoor
0007f35f96
Lint
2019-01-12 19:23:19 -08:00